POSITION OVERVIEW

Under the direction of the JHTT Quality Manager, the Product Safety Specialist is responsible for supporting Johnson Health Tech North America’s product safety program through investigation, evaluation, documentation, and continuous improvement of product safety. This role works side by side with Product Safety Technicians to review product safety reports, evaluate returned products, identify trends, and help implement corrective actions that reduce risk and improve product performance. The Product Safety Specialist provides day-to-day oversight of technicians while partnering cross-functionally with Customer Technical Service, Quality, R&D, Operations, Legal, and Factory Teams. This is an individual contributor role and does not include formal people management or supervisory responsibility. This role is in office 5 days a week. 


RESPONSIBILITIES

Product Safety: 

  • Review product safety reports, customer complaints, and related data to identify potential safety issues, emerging trends, and areas for corrective action 
  • Compile documentation for section 15(b) reports to CPSC 
  • Work side by side with the Product Safety Technician to evaluate returned products, support inspections, document findings, and help determine root cause 
  • Provide day-to-day guidance to the Product Safety Technician regarding case review, product evaluation, documentation quality, and follow-up actions 
  • Conduct product safety evaluations and risk assessments to support decision making for product improvements, containment actions, and field remedies as needed 
  • Document investigation results, prepare clear technical reports, maintain accurate records of product safety evaluations, returned unit reviews, and related actions 
  • Partner with Customer Technical Service, Quality, R&D, Operations, legal, and factory teams to communicate findings, coordinate investigations, and support timely resolution of product safety concerns 
  • Support the development and continuous improvement of product safety procedures, training materials, and standard work 
  • Monitor applicable product safety requirements, standards, and best practices and help incorporate them into internal processes and product evaluations
